Regardless of the shape of the bootstrap sampling distribution, we can use the percentile method to construct a confidence interval. Using this method, the 95% confidence interval is the range of points that cover the middle 95% of bootstrap sampling distribution. The following examples use StatKey.

StatKey is a great app for analyzing data. For analyzing a single data set, select the One Quantitative Variable option. Then select Edit Data. Delete the data there, type a title for your data set, and paste your data in. The title and each number in your data list should be on a new line, no commas.
